Understanding Injectable Hormone Therapy

Injectable hormone therapy utilizes substances directly into the body to regulate hormonal levels. This strategy can be used to manage a range of conditions, amongst menopause, decreased testosterone, and transgender hormone replacement therapy. Healthcare providers will carefully examine your individual needs to identify the right type and dosage of medications for you.

The Science Behind Injectable Steroid Action

Injectable steroids work by replicating the effects of naturally generated hormones in the body. These synthetically created compounds, primarily corticosteroids, are introduced directly into the bloodstream targeting various tissues and organs. Upon entry, they bind to specific molecules within cells, activating a cascade of biochemical reactions. This ultimately produces in a range of physiological responses, depending more info on the variety of steroid used and the quantity injected.

  • Certain steroids, like testosterone, are anabolic, stimulating protein synthesis and muscle growth.
  • Alternative steroids, such as corticosteroids, have anti-inflammatory effects, used to alleviate conditions like arthritis and asthma.

However, inappropriate use of injectable steroids can lead a variety of unwanted effects, including liver damage, cardiovascular problems, and hormonal disruptions.
